Alright, I received the zebra-wood veneer a couple days ago, managed to get it cut.installed it yesterday, turned out pretty good.

[attachment=16665]

I spent the week with grain filler, and sanding sealer, then the zebra-wood veneer, today I sprayed 2 coats of Mohawk ultra flo clear Lacquer. Tomorrow a little light sanding, then 2 more coats of lacquer. Then see where I stand. heres a picture of one side, got too dark to do the other side.

[attachment=16666]
